Springs

Coil-shaped springs are used for support, helping to evenly distribute weight and reduce pressure points. Innerspring mattresses usually come in four varieties: continuous, Bonnell, offset, and pocketed coils. Various types of springs have different levels of firmness and offer different grades of comfort.

It consists of a box spring, which is a wooden foundation with springs. Metal coil springs in the box spring help to absorb the shock of movement and weight when people get in or out of bed.

Bed frames

The bed frame you choose is important because it has a major impact on the look of your room. Most beds have frames made of wood or metal, and they come in a variety of styles.

The most common types are platform beds, sleigh beds, canopy beds, four-poster beds and bunk beds. Whichever type you choose, make sure the frame is stable and sturdy enough to support the weight of your mattress.

Bunk beds are raised off the ground and consist of one or two beds. They are designed for adults or children and often come with a ladder.
